How to Earn Points

Six ways points actually accumulate, from card spending to dining programs, ranked by how much they move the needle.

๐Ÿ’ณ

Credit card spending

The fastest path. Premium cards earn 3โ€“10ร— on travel, dining, and groceries. Sign-up bonuses alone โ€” often 60,000โ€“100,000 points โ€” can cover a round-trip business class ticket.

โœˆ๏ธ

Actually flying

Miles earned per flight depend on the airline, fare class, and your elite status. Premium cabins and full-fare economy earn the most. Business travel is a goldmine.

๐Ÿ›๏ธ

Shopping portals

Airlines and banks run online shopping portals (Chase, United, Delta, etc.) where clicking through to retailers like Apple, Nike, or Best Buy earns bonus miles on purchases you'd make anyway.

๐Ÿจ

Hotel stays

Booking directly with hotel chains earns points and qualifies you for elite status benefits: free breakfast, room upgrades, late checkout. Co-branded hotel cards accelerate earning dramatically.

๐Ÿฝ๏ธ

Dining programs

American, Delta, and United all have dining programs that earn miles for eating at enrolled restaurants โ€” no card swipe required beyond registering once.

๐Ÿ‘ฅ

Referrals & offers

Referring friends to card applications earns large bonuses. Amex Offers and Chase Offers add statement credits on targeted spending โ€” free money if you're already spending there.
